Dark and savoury Shiraz Mourvedre - a national treasure from the Western Cape. Rich, dark and brooding, packed with warm, chocolate notes and a big savoury heart.
Excellent with roast lamb.

Full yet elegant with bramble fruit aromas, cassis and black cherry flavours on the palate and a touch of white pepper spice (more in the northern Rhone mould than Barossa brawn) - structure provided by fine tannins with a long rich, ripe finish.
Made from 65 year old bush vine Cinsault - a true national treasure from the Western Cape. Deeply flavoursome, gently compelling yet exotically spicy. This is purely elegant, restrained Cinsault.
